Emishiki Shuzo was founded in 1892 in Minakuchi, Shiga Prefecture, along the old Tokaido highway, and named its flagship brand with the wish that sake could bring laughter and connection through every season. Under fifth-generation brewmaster Takashima Mitsunori, the brewery commits to additive-free, pure rice brewing using Shiga Prefecture contract rice and two distinct spring water sources blended according to each sake's character. The house style is built around clean sweetness rather than aromatic intensity, achieved through natural fermentation and unfiltered, unadjusted bottling.
